### FARE-812: Signature check failing on pricing experiment rollout

The Tollbooth A/B bundle for the dynamic-pricing experiment fails verification at deploy time, even though CI signs it successfully. I traced it to the verifier loading a stale key from the orchestrator cache; the bundle itself is intact. Reviewer, please confirm my cache-busting fix is sound and that verification uses the key below.

deploy key for kajof-fajop: bky6_gDHw9Q

Ticket: ClinicCue reminder job skipped the morning batch for the Ashgrove practice. Patients with appointments before 9am received no SMS or email. The scheduler logged a timezone parse failure and silently exited instead of retrying. Workaround: support can trigger a manual resend from the admin panel. The failed run is identifiable by the trace token below.

pipeline stamp: htk9_ce63042d9

Thanks for the plugin submission to the Tindervale loyalty ledger. One concern: your accrual hook writes points synchronously, but the ledger applies rate limits per partner plugin, so bursts will be rejected. Please buffer writes and respect the published ceilings; otherwise reconciliation in the Moorland settlement job will flag your entries. For reference, the current limits your plugin must honor are below.

limits module of bageg-bahof:
RATE_LIMITS = {
    "druwyn": 10,
    "oliael": 10,
    "holwyn": 1,
    "wenath": 1,
}

# ReceiptRelay Plugin Onboarding

ReceiptRelay sends donation receipts on behalf of nonprofits using the Givewell Harbor platform. Plugin authors run a local sandbox that mimics the production mailer. Copy env.sample to .env, then set MAILER_MODE=sandbox and RECEIPT_LOCALE=en. Receipts render from templates in the /layouts folder; do not edit shipped templates directly. To let the sandbox sign outgoing receipt payloads, add the signing secret on the next line.

secret setting of fawep-tagaf: ARCHIVE_KEY3=ce5